WebEffects of Rohypnol Abuse on the Brain Roofies work to depress brain function and CNS activity, and it can accomplish this to a profound degree. It has a potent tranquilizing effect, and many users have described it as “paralyzing.” This dramatic reduction in activity in the brain and body is compounded when it is used in conjunction with alcohol. WebRohypnol is also used in combination with alcohol to produce an exaggerated intoxication. In addition, abuse of Rohypnol® may be associated with multiple-substance abuse. For example, cocaine users may use benzodiazepines such as Rohypnol® to relieve the side effects (e.g., irritability and agitation) associated with cocaine binges. Webvomiting exhaustion sluggishness amnesia confusion clumsiness GHB can have an addictive potential if used repeatedly. Withdrawal effects may include insomnia, anxiety, tremors, sweating, increased heart rate and blood pressure, or psychotic thoughts. Withdrawal can be severe and incapacitating.
